Non-cooperarive uffd events are inherently racy and can happen in
parallel with other userfaultfd operations.
During event tests in uffd-unit-tests, the uffd monitor calls
UFFDIO_UNREGISTER upon receiving UFFD_EVENT_REMOVE.
In parallel, the faulting_process() verifies that the removed memory is
actually zeroed.
If a verification read wins the race with UFFDIO_UNREGISTER, it causes a
missing fault that uffd monitor would receive after UFFDIO_UNREGISTER is
complete. The monitor resolves the fault using UFFDIO_COPY that fails
with -ENOENT which means that VMA has been changed (see commit
27d02568f529 ("userfaultfd: mcopy_atomic: return -ENOENT when no
compatible VMA found")).
Treat -ENOENT returned by UFFDIO_COPY as non-fatal, the same way
-EEXIST is treated for concurrent faults, and don't fail the test.

I've noticed transient faults of uffd-unit-tests in the CI runs [1]
and found this issue with uffd-unit-tests.
The issue is longstanding and it's not related to or exposed by the
recent uffd refactoring.
I didn't even look for a Fixes: commit, as this is a selftest only and I
don't see a reason to backport it.
